The runtime — pgCK

pgCK is the Concept Kernel runtime: a PostgreSQL extension composed on pgRDF. The line from v0.1.0 to the current v0.4.21 is thirty-seven CI-built, provenance-attested releases. The milestones that built the v3.9.1 typed surface:

ReleaseWhat it added
v0.4.4Generic typed instance.create — a uniform {type, …fields} body routed against the kernel's own declared SHACL shape.
v0.4.5Governance apply mutates the kernel shape — a quorum-approved proposal now translates into the kernel graph before the epoch bump, so consensus actually evolves the type.
v0.4.6instance.reach traverses participant-created links — edge.create writes the traversable quad.
v0.4.7Governed query affordances — a kernel seals a parameterized SPARQL query as a verb; callers bind typed parameters only.
v0.4.8instance.query derived QueryShape — filter keys validated against the type's declared properties.
v0.4.9instance.link / reach gate on the kernel's declared predicate set.
v0.4.10Per-kernel sealed transition map — instance.transition governed by the type's own sealed map.
v0.4.11Declared-shape instance.update patch — re-sealed, the proof chain continues.
v0.4.12Full SHACL ValidationReport via instance.validate — typed violations (datatype, cardinality, node-kind, pattern).
v0.4.13Governed concept.match — label search served by a sealed governed plan; callers bind term.
v0.4.14The authorized CK-loop writer and uniform instance id-form — enforcement is real through the dispatch door; the link → reach round-trip works on the ids clients hold.
v0.4.15Provenance id-form symmetry — provenance(bare) and provenance(@id) return the same envelope.
v0.4.16Per-session result routing.
v0.4.17The seal gate honors full W3C SHACL Core — validate conforms if and only if seal accepts, across cardinality, sh:in, sh:datatype, sh:maxCount, sh:pattern, and sh:nodeKind.
v0.4.18v0.4.20Distribution coherence and stabilization on the shipped bundle, and the derived-read plane the scoring-loop direction builds on.
v0.4.21create_typed files the core lifecycle key (lifecycle_state) at create, so a freshly created instance transitions cleanly — closing the create → transition path.

Each release is verified against its GHCR digests by gh attestation verify before LATEST.md advances. The full per-release record is the pgCK CHANGELOG.md.

The client — cklib

cklib is the dispatch-only client, twenty-six releases from v1.0.0 to the current v1.5.4.

ReleaseWhat it added
v1.5.1The typed-edge forms — kernel-derived typed operations (create, query, transition, update, validate, match) mirroring the pgCK tracks, plus the canonical NATS wire-contract.
v1.5.2create passes every caller field through — a kernel's declared shape can require any of them; verified against real enforcement.
v1.5.3Public-surface hygiene; npm publish-on-tag wiring with Sigstore/OIDC provenance, flag-gated and deferred.
v1.5.4The derived-read client surface — doFresh / isRecomputing handle the substrate's honest recompute-in-progress reply with backoff, never returning a stale value. The client-side groundwork the v3.10 scoring loop direction builds on.

Distribution

cklib ships as an attested OCI bundle (ghcr.io/conceptkernel/ck-lib-js). The npm publish path is wired with provenance and gated on a repository flag; it is deferred until npm authentication lands.
